But I’m going to have you toss that image aside because Romania’s Zmeu (pronounced zmeh-oo) isn’t your typical dragon. Imagine a mix of dragon, demon, and trickster–that’s a Zmeu! It’s like someone dipped a dragon in a vat of folklore, and this fascinating blend of magical mayhem emerged. Or maybe the dragon version of everyone’s favorite Loki.

The Zmeu is a legendary creature deeply rooted in Romanian folklore. Often depicted as a dragon-like creature, it boasts scaly skin, sharp claws, and sometimes even wings. Its fiery breath and formidable strength add to its aura of power and danger. However, the Zmeu isn’t merely a monster; it’s a complex character that reflects various facets of human nature and the cultural landscape of Romania.

The Zmeu isn’t always a symbol of malevolence. In some tales, it takes on a more complex role, one as a romantic figure. These stories often involve a Zmeu who kidnaps a beautiful maiden, prompting a daring hero to embark on a perilous journey to rescue her. Not unlike your traditional damsel in distress trapped in a tower guarded by a dragon. Except, in this case, the Zmeu might appear as a handsome trickster. (Or, again, maybe a Hiddleston Loki?)

This narrative reflects themes of love, sacrifice, and the eternal struggle between good and evil.
